The 3/4 ton C20 was well-suited to having a camper permanently installed in the bed, and came with a heavier suspension and other changes to support a higher payload and towing capacity than the more pedestrian 1/2 ton C10. Between the two, coil springs ride better than leaf springs, but burdened with a heavier load, coils springs will make the truck's rear end shimmy and sway like a willow tree. In Chevrolet's words, "The high, wide windshield means safer, more convenient viewing," but in reality, it meant visual distortion with bad optics created by the tight curves (bends) in the ends of the windshield glass. The fast way to identify the 1966 model year, provided the 1966 Chevy C10 Fleetside or Stepside truck is unmolested, is that the rearview will find backup lights mounted on the rear fenders adjacent on a Stepside and under the taillights on a Fleetside. The Big-Window rear window was a low-cost option at the time that added considerably to the truck's resale value in the decades to follow. While Chevy C10 trucks revised grille designs four years in a row, GMC trucks maintained the same grille design from 1960 to 1966.
